http://help.zavvi.com/index.php?action=artikel&cat=5&id=18&artlang=en

We charge your credit or debit card for the majority of items once your item is leaving our warehouse. Payment is usually taken within 48 hours of point of dispatch.

However, please note that orders placed for electronics and computing items are charged at the point of placing the order not at point of dispatch as with other products.
